CulebrONT

CulebrONT automates genome assembly and evaluation from long-read sequencing data for prokaryotic and eukaryotic genomes.


Key Features:

  • Workflow management: Uses Snakemake to provide a scalable, modular, and traceable workflow framework.
  • Multiple assembler support: Enables parallel testing across multiple long-read assemblers and samples.
  • Downstream processing: Provides optional circularization and polishing steps to improve assembly contiguity and accuracy.
  • Assembly quality assessment: Compiles a suite of assembly quality metrics into a report for comparative evaluation.
  • Input data: Operates on raw long-read sequencing reads for both prokaryotic and eukaryotic genomes.

Scientific Applications:

  • High-quality genome assembly: Producing contiguous assemblies for genomic studies requiring high-quality genomes.
  • Complex eukaryotic genome assembly: Handling assembly of complex eukaryotic genomes using long-read data.
  • Prokaryotic genome assembly: Assembling diverse prokaryotic species with support for circularization.
  • Comparative assembler evaluation: Parallel testing of assemblers and samples to identify optimal assembly configurations.

Methodology:

Uses Snakemake to orchestrate parallel execution of multiple long-read assemblers across samples, performs optional circularization and polishing, and compiles assembly quality metrics into a report.
